Dong Bortey Confident On Black Stars Return

Aduana Stars ace Bernard Dong Bortey believes recent national team call-ups to home-based players have given his international career a boost. Ghana Premier League outfield players Richard Mpong and Emmanuel Baffour staked a claim for locally-players in the Black Stars by impressing in last week�s friendly against Chile. Head coach Goran Stevanovic is prepared to hand playing times for talents in the Ghana top flight is a busy year which contains the 2013 Africa Cup of Nations and 2014 FIFA World Cup qualifiers. At 30, Bortey is confident his qualities can catch the eyes of the Serbian trainer who is expected to be retained as Black Stars coach. �No. I have not given up on the Black Stars. If the coach sees my performance in the league, I am sure that he will hand me a call-up,� the former Ghana Under-17 star told Asempa FM. Bortey has six Ghana caps and played a crucial part in the preliminaries qualifiers to the 2006 FIFA World Cup finals in Germany.
